What is Google Satellite Downloader?
Google Satellite Downloader is an innovative tool designed specifically for downloading satellite imagery from Google Earth Engine (GEE). GEE provides access to a vast array of satellite data, including Landsat, Sentinel-2, and MODIS, among others. The downloader simplifies the process of acquiring these datasets, making them easily available for use in various applications such as remote sensing analysis, environmental monitoring, and urban planning.
